Before diving into the specific codes for motor vehicle seats, let's briefly explain what HS codes are. The Harmonized System is an international nomenclature developed by the World Customs Organization (WCO) for the classification of goods. It consists of six-digit codes that are used by customs authorities worldwide to identify products for the application of duties and taxes, as well as for collecting trade statistics.
The primary HS code category for motor vehicle seats falls under Chapter 94, which covers "Furniture; bedding, mattresses, mattress supports, cushions and similar stuffed furnishings; lamps and lighting fittings, not elsewhere specified or included; illuminated signs, illuminated name-plates and the like; prefabricated buildings." Specifically, motor vehicle seats are classified under heading 9401.
